Another staycation idea is to hold a video game tournament. It is possible to play on a table or on a gaming console. You can even do it on Wii Sports or Guitar Hero. It can be even more fun to name your team.
Another option is to go to a drive-in cinema. Many cities host them during the summer months. They serve classics as well new releases. Make sure you bring a snack, a camera and enjoy the show.
Staycations can be fun and affordable, including a picnic at a local forest preserve or a breakfast trip to a favorite restaurant. Some hotels offer convenient amenities for families, like pack-n–plays and adjoining areas. The activities you choose will depend on your budget and time.

Is it safe to let my child climb trees?
Trees are strong structures. But climbing trees presents risks if your child isn't able to assess his or her physical capabilities.
You have to use both hands and legs to get higher when climbing a tree. This means your child needs to be able to use both arms and legs to maintain balance.
Your child will need to be able jump between branches easily. This requires strength and agility.
Don't force your child to climb trees if she isn't ready.
It's possible to climb trees together, by sitting on lower limbs or using ladders. Or you can sit on a branch and read books to each other.
